The short version
Above-average SATs results. Nearly full.
- SATs results are above the national average, with 67% meeting the expected standard (national: 62%)
- This is a Church of England school, so faith criteria may apply to admissions
- The school is nearly full at 93% capacity

Attendance
In practice: Pupils miss about 10 days per year on average — about two weeks of school.
10% of pupils miss 10% or more of school
2% of pupils miss half or more of school sessions
Source: DfE School Census
Staffing
On average, 23 pupils share each qualified teacher, but with teaching assistants there's 1 adult for every 15 pupils.

How many pupils attend Newick Church of England Primary School?
Newick Church of England Primary School currently has 204 pupils on roll, according to the latest Department for Education data.
What ages does Newick Church of England Primary School take?
Newick Church of England Primary School caters for pupils aged 4 to 11. It is classified as a primary school.
Where is Newick Church of England Primary School?
Newick Church of England Primary School is in Lewes, BN8 4NB, in the East Sussex local authority area. The map on this page shows the exact location and nearby schools.
Does Newick Church of England Primary School have a sixth form?
No, Newick Church of England Primary School does not have a sixth form. Pupils move to a different school or college for post-16 study.
